Spacey to Play Jailed Lobbyist Abramoff

DC scammer looking forward to telling his side

(Newser) – Kevin Spacey met with lobbyist-extraordinaire-turned-convict Jack Abramoff yesterday to discuss the actor’s portrayal of him in the upcoming Casino Jack, Deadline Hollywood Daily reports. The jailed Abramoff, convicted of scamming American Indians out of millions in casino money, is reportedly a huge Spacey fan. “For two guys who couldn't be more different, they seemed to get along very well,” said an insider.
